AI Contract Overview
The contract requires strict adherence to OSHA 29 CFR 1910.1200 and DFARS 252.223-7001 for the accurate application of hazard warning labels on all hazardous materials. It mandates the full generation of Safety Data Sheets in compliance with global standards and ensures all packaging and storage practices meet MIL-STD-129 requirements for uniform marking and labeling. The work must be performed at Pearl Harbor, Hawaii, with delivery and compliance obligations tied to the Department of Defense’s Maritime Supply Chain ESOC Buys division. The subcontract opportunity is open for response until August 12, 2026, and falls under NAICS code 561990 for other support services, targeting vendors with proven expertise in hazardous materials handling, documentation, and military logistics standards.
